What is a Green Burial?

Green burial, also called natural burial, is simply an earth-friendly way to be laid to rest. It avoids using things that can harm the environment, keeping the process clean and simple. This means we skip the usual toxic chemicals, like embalming fluid, and instead of using heavy metal or concrete vaults, we allow the body to return naturally to the soil. For the container, only items that are easily biodegradable are used—like a simple cloth wrapping or a plain wooden box, made from sustainable materials such as pine or bamboo. Essentially, green burial is about making your final wishes sustainable, beautiful, and natural, ensuring the resting place supports the health of the land.

Green Burial Basics:

  • No Toxic Chemicals: Embalming is replaced by natural refrigeration or immediate burial.


  • Biodegradable Caskets & Shrouds: We require the use of caskets made from sustainable materials like pine, wicker, or bamboo, or a simple natural linen shroud.


  • No Vaults: Traditional concrete or steel burial vaults are not used, allowing for direct contact with the soil.


  • Natural Grave Markers: Graves are marked by a simple, flat stone or a natural fieldstone that blends into the environment, maintaining the area’s natural beauty.

Green Burial FAQs

  • Is a green burial legally recognized in North Carolina?

    Yes, green burial is a legally recognized and accepted practice in North Carolina.

  • Are there headstones or markers?

    To maintain the natural aesthetic of the grounds, grave markers are typically flat, unpolished fieldstones or simple, eco-friendly plaques that lie flush with the ground.

  • Can we still have a service or visitation?

    Absolutely. We work with families to arrange meaningful natural funeral services at the graveside that honor the deceased while respecting the commitment to sustainability.
